General Description
5-Bromobenzo[c][1,2,5]oxadiazole oxide is a chemical compound with the formula C7H3BrN2O2. It is a heterocyclic compound containing an oxadiazole ring that is substituted with a bromine atom. 5-broMobenzo[c][1,2,5]oxadiazole oxide has potential applications in the field of organic electronics and materials science, where it can be used as a building block for the synthesis of functional materials and organic semiconductors. It is also known for its fluorescence properties, making it useful as a fluorescent probe in biological and chemical sensing applications. Additionally, its unique structure and properties make it a subject of interest in the study of various chemical reactions and organic synthesis methodologies.
Check Digit Verification of cas no
The CAS Registry Mumber 36387-84-5 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 3,6,3,8 and 7 respectively; the second part has 2 digits, 8 and 4 respectively.
Calculate Digit Verification of CAS Registry Number 36387-84:
(7*3)+(6*6)+(5*3)+(4*8)+(3*7)+(2*8)+(1*4)=145
145 % 10 = 5
So 36387-84-5 is a valid CAS Registry Number.

Cu-Catalyzed π-Core Evolution of Benzoxadiazoles with Diaryliodonium Salts for Regioselective Synthesis of Phenazine Scaffolds
Sheng, Jinyu,He, Ru,Xue, Jie,Wu, Chao,Qiao, Juan,Chen, Chao
supporting information, p. 4458 - 4461 (2018/08/09)
The Cu-catalyzed regioselective synthesis of phenazine N-oxides was realized from benzoxadiazoles and diaryliodonium salts. The process was initiated by the electrophilic arylation of benzoxadiazoles with diaryliodonium salts and followed by benzocyclization reactions. The further reduction of N-oxides in situ to phenazine scaffolds and deviation to organic fluorescent materials were readily accomplished.
